Turnips are loaded with fiber and vitamins K, A, C, E, B1, B3, B5, B6, B2 and folate (one of the B vitamins), as well as minerals like manganese, potassium, magnesium, iron, calcium and copper. They are also a good source of phosphorus, omega-3 fatty acids and protein. The lactobacilli which produce lactic acid during the natural pickling process improves digestion and produces enzymes that work towards strengthening our immune system. Fermenting the turnips actually boost their vitamin and antioxidant content!
Some ways to use: chop and add to green salad, use the brine to make your own probiotic salad dressing, dice up and add to potato salad, slice as side to curry dish or simply just have a few as a healthy probiotic snack!
